What is the ÖSD B2 Certificate?
The ÖSD B2 certificate evaluates a candidate's German language abilities at an upper-intermediate level, corresponding to the 4th level (B2) on the Common European Framework of Reference for Languages (CEFR). At this phase, students are anticipated to interact spontaneously and fluently, making regular interaction with native speakers possible without stress for either party.

Among the defining features of the [B1 ÖSD](https://brewer-falkenberg-3.mdwrite.net/10-websites-to-help-you-be-a-pro-in-osd-certificate) is its "pluricentric" approach. Unlike some other certificates that focus strictly on High German (Hochdeutsch) as utilized in Germany, the ÖSD acknowledges the linguistic range of the German-speaking world, including standard variations from Austria, Germany, and Switzerland.

The ÖSD B2 exam is modular, meaning it includes two primary parts: the Written Examination (Reading, Listening, Writing) and the Oral Examination (Speaking). Prospects have the flexibility to take these parts independently or together.
1. Reading (Lesen)
In this area, prospects need to show their capability to understand a range of texts, such as news article, reports, and official ads. The focus is on recognizing both global significance and specific information.
2. Listening (Hören)
The listening module utilizes genuine recordings from numerous German-speaking areas. Prospects listen to brief conversations, radio broadcasts, and lectures to draw out key info and comprehend various viewpoints.
3. Writing (Schreiben)
The composing part requires the production of clear, in-depth texts. Usually, prospects need to finish two jobs:
A formal e-mail or letter (e.g., a grievance or a query).An argumentative essay or viewpoint piece on a modern social problem.4. Speaking (Sprechen)
The oral exam typically takes location with 2 examiners. It involves a conversation between the candidate and the examiner or a dialogue in between two prospects. The jobs consist of a presentation on a particular subject and a discussion/debate.

To pass the ÖSD B2, candidates must accomplish a minimum rating in both the composed and oral areas. If a prospect passes just one module (e.g., the Written Exam however not the Oral), they receive a partial certificate and can retake the failed portion within a particular timeframe (usually one year).
Composed Exam Scoring: The Reading, Listening, and Writing scores are combined. A common question for learners is whether to select the ÖSD or the Goethe-Zertifikat. Both are highly appreciated and basically comparable in regards to problem and CEFR positioning.

The main difference lies in the linguistic focus. The Goethe-[OSD Zertifikat C1](https://stevendancer8.werite.net/is-buy-b2-certificate-as-vital-as-everyone-says) focuses primarily on the German used within Germany. The ÖSD, however, values the "pluricentric" nature of the language. For instance, in an [ÖSD Zertifikat In Deutschland Anerkannt](https://pad.geolab.space/s/iM6JRzBEB) exam, using the Austrian word Jänner instead of the German Januar is completely acceptable, as long as it is utilized correctly. Many trainees find the ÖSD's modular system-- enabling the separation of written and oral parts-- to be a little more flexible depending on the regional test center's offerings.
Often Asked Questions (FAQ)1. For how long is the ÖSD B2 certificate valid?
The certificate does not have a main expiration date. However, many companies and universities require proof of language proficiency that is no older than 2 years.
2. Can I utilize a dictionary throughout the exam?
Yes, for the B2 level, prospects are allowed to utilize a monolingual or multilingual dictionary throughout the Reading and Writing modules. However, no dictionaries are allowed throughout the Listening or Speaking portions.
3. Where can I take the ÖSD B2 exam?
Exams are held at certified ÖSD assessment centers internationally. These consist of language schools, universities, and Austrian Cultural Forums.
4. The length of time does it require to get the results?
Generally, results and certificates are readily available within 4 to 6 weeks after the evaluation date, though this can vary depending on the center.
5. What takes place if I stop working one part of the exam?
Since the ÖSD is modular, if a candidate fails the Speaking section however passes the Written area, they just require to retake the Speaking portion to earn the complete B2 certificate.
